Why is it sunny outside one day and rainy the next? Readers will learn the ins and outs of why weather changes in this book. Accessible text and appealing photos show changing weather conditions and encourage students to observe and think about the changing weather in their own environments.
This first nonfiction reader uses short concise sentences and vivid color photographs to give basic information about changing weather. The small, easy-to-hold size of books in this Let’s Watch the Weather series make them great choices for beginning readers. Vocabulary words highlighted with bold face font and the included glossary and index makes this a good choice for teaching basic nonfiction reading.
